Navigation device, method of predicting a visibility of a triangular face in an electronic map view

A navigation device (1) for a vehicle (8) comprises a database (2a, 2b) storing, for a plurality of tiles of a tiling, at least one triangulated irregular network, TIN, defining a three-dimensional surface, and, for a plurality of triangular faces of the at least one TIN, control information defining a nested bounding sphere for the respective triangular faces. The navigation device (1) comprises further a processor (3) coupled to said database (2a, 2b), configured to calculate a screen-space error for the plurality of triangular faces based on the respective control information (16) and based on at least one of the following: a viewing angle of an electronic map view, a virtual camera position of the electronic map view. The processor is configured to predict whether a triangular face is visible in the electronic map view based on the calculated screen-space error.
